Abstract

The quickly online provision for disengagement of a kind of ladle upper nozzle, belongs to ladle maintenance tool technical field, for ladle upper nozzle carries out the most online dismounting.Its technical scheme is: it includes air-cooled push rod, pull head, pull bar, hollow jack, bracing frame, give a dinner for a visitor from afar device for cooling in air-cooled push rod one end, the other end with pull head for being flexibly connected, the round platform of the major diameter at pull head rear portion is stuck in the outside of the ladle inner face of filling pipe end, the front portion of pull head is connected through filling pipe end in ladle with the front end of pull bar, pull bar passes hollow jack, and bracing frame is outside ladle bottom and between hollow jack.The present invention can be rapidly completed the online dismounting of ladle upper nozzle, and the time pulling out, replacing with the mouth of a river shortens to 3 ~ 5 minutes, substantially increases operating efficiency, it also avoid the damage resistance to material of ladle bottom, adds ladle life.Design science of the present invention rationally, simple in construction, easy to use, solve the difficult problem changing ladle upper nozzle not solved for a long time.

Description

The quickly online provision for disengagement of a kind of ladle upper nozzle
Technical field
The present invention relates to a kind of ladle upper nozzle quickly online extracting tool, belong to ladle maintenance tool technical field.
Background technology
In STEELMAKING PRODUCTION, ladle prepares to be to ensure that, with maintenance, the most important thing that whole steel making working procedure is stably carried out.Each ladle has two set mouth of a river sled mechanism, and the resistance to material composition of Mei Tao mechanism includes brick cup, lower brick cup, filling pipe end, the lower mouth of a river, upper slide, lower skateboard, and sled mechanism material resistance to ladle bottom gap is filled by corundum castable.Wherein filling pipe end average life span is 8 ~ 9 stoves, and filling pipe end is rear-loading type, it is necessary to mount and dismount at ladle bottom.Traditional mouth of a river method that replaces with is to stretch in ladle with overhead traveling crane big bar of slinging, several workers operate big bar longitudinal oscillation at big bar afterbody and clash into filling pipe end, until coming off.Owing to big bar suspension centre can around swing, operation easily strikes the resistance to material in other positions of ladle bottom, causes resistance to material to damage, reduce ladle life.Adopting in this way, 7 ~ 8 worker continuous firing 20 ~ 30 minutes in hot environment of one-stop operation palpus, operating environment is severe, and operation immediately below overhead traveling crane, there is bigger potential safety hazard.Meanwhile, this operation also needs to take an overhead traveling crane, affects the normal operation of other operations, affects greatly the continuity of whole production, does not has good solution so far.
Summary of the invention
The technical problem to be solved provides a kind of online provision for disengagement of ladle upper nozzle, this online provision for disengagement can reduce the take-down time of filling pipe end, quick-replaceable filling pipe end, site safety can be improved simultaneously, reduce the labour intensity of worker, reduce the impact on other operation normal operation.
The technical scheme solving above-mentioned technical problem is:
The quickly online provision for disengagement of a kind of ladle upper nozzle, it includes air-cooled push rod, pull head, pull bar, hollow jack, bracing frame, air-cooled push rod is made up of stainless-steel pipe, give a dinner for a visitor from afar device for cooling in one end, the other end with pull head for being flexibly connected, there is the round platform of major diameter at the rear portion of pull head, round platform is stuck in the outside of the ladle inner face of filling pipe end, the front portion of pull head arrives outside ladle bottom through filling pipe end in ladle, the front end of pull head is connected with the front end of pull bar, pull bar passes hollow jack, there is screw thread at the rear portion of pull bar, screw is spun on the screw thread at pull bar rear portion, bracing frame is outside ladle bottom and between hollow jack, the two ends of bracing frame are in close contact with hollow jack front end with outside ladle bottom respectively, pull head, pull bar is positioned at the cavity of bracing frame.
The quickly online provision for disengagement of above-mentioned ladle upper nozzle, the rear portion of described pull head is hollow structure, and the front end of air-cooled push rod is inserted in the rear cavity of pull head, and the front end of pull head is discount structure, the front end of pull bar is discount structure, and the discount of pull head is interlockingly connected with the discount of pull bar.
The quickly online provision for disengagement of above-mentioned ladle upper nozzle, it also has pull head clamper, is fixed by pull head gripper after pull head and pull bar snapping, and pull head clamper is positioned at the cavity of bracing frame.
The quickly online provision for disengagement of above-mentioned ladle upper nozzle, it also has mast-up, mast-up to have rotation, traveling, elevating mechanism, and the vertical loading board of mast-up is connected with hollow jack.
The quickly online provision for disengagement of above-mentioned ladle upper nozzle, it also has roller, roller to be arranged on before steel ladle opening on fire-screen door frame, and air-cooled push-rod frame is on roller.
The invention has the beneficial effects as follows:
The present invention uses pull head, pull bar, jack pair ladle upper nozzle to carry out tractive dismounting, the online dismounting of ladle upper nozzle can be rapidly completed, the time pulling out, replacing with the mouth of a river was shortened to current 3 ~ 5 minute by original 20 ~ 30 minutes, substantially increase operating efficiency, it also avoid the damage resistance to material of ladle bottom, reduce stuffing sand addition, add ladle life.The present invention need not overhead traveling crane coordinating operation in operation, has liberated an overhead traveling crane, and the direct motion produced is produced positive meaning, and operation Employee population is reduced to current 4 worker by original 7 ~ 8 simultaneously, has saved human resources, improves the working environment of worker.Design science of the present invention rationally, simple in construction, easy to use, solve the difficult problem changing ladle upper nozzle not solved for a long time, production had the most significant realistic meaning.

Detailed description of the invention
The present invention is made up of air-cooled push rod 2, roller 3, pull head 5, pull bar 11, pull head clamper 8, hollow jack 9, bracing frame 7, mast-up 10.
Showing in figure, air-cooled push rod 2 is made up of stainless-steel pipe, and a termination cooling duct 1, the other end welds a thin steel column of segment length 40mm, for being connected with pull head 5.Air-cooled push rod 2 frame is on roller 3, and roller 3 is arranged on ladle 4 and wraps before mouth on fire-screen door frame, and air-cooled push rod 2 can penetrate filling pipe end 6 in promoting and pull head 5 is sent into bag on roller 2 and be connected with pull bar 11.
Showing in figure, pull head 5 is made by stainless steel, and hollow one end, one end is solid, and the front end of air-cooled push rod 2 is inserted in the rear cavity of pull head 5, and solid position car goes out discount, for being connected with the discount of pull bar 11 front end.There is the round platform of major diameter at the rear portion of pull head 5, round platform is stuck in the outside of the ladle inner face of filling pipe end 6, the front portion of pull head 5 arrives ladle 4 bottom outside through filling pipe end 6 in ladle 4, and when pull head 5 is pulled out by pull bar 11, filling pipe end 6 is outwards taken out of by the rear portion round platform of pull head 5 together.
Showing in figure, pull bar 11 is through hollow jack 9, and the rear portion of pull bar 11 has screw thread, screw to be spun on the screw thread at pull bar 11 rear portion.The discount of pull bar 11 is interlockingly connected with pull head 5, can the most quickly connect, and the screw-nut of pull bar 11 is used for regulating stroke.
Showing in figure, pull head 5 is gripped by pull head clamper 8 after pull bar 11 snapping.
Showing in figure, bracing frame 7 is between ladle 4 bottom outside and hollow jack 9, and the two ends of bracing frame 7 are in close contact with hollow jack 9 front end with ladle 4 bottom outside respectively, and pull head 5, pull bar 11 and pull head clamper 8 are positioned at the cavity of bracing frame 7.Bracing frame 7 can be stablized and be accurately positioned, and is used for supporting hollow jack 9 drawing recoil and stablizing centering hollow jack 9.
Showing in figure, the vertical loading board of mast-up 10 is connected with hollow jack 9, and mast-up 10 has rotation, traveling, elevating mechanism, and quick for hollow jack 9 is moved.
The course of work of the present invention is as follows:
Bracing frame 7 is fixed in ladle bottom mechanism, moves hollow jack 9 to working position, switch on power;
Pull head 5 is inserted in air-cooled push rod 2 head, and cooling duct 1 opens cooling wind, and air-cooled push rod 2 frame, on roller 3, promotes air-cooled push rod 2 pull head 5 pushes ladle 4 and sends in filling pipe end 6;
Use pull head clamper 8 to interlock fixing by pull bar 11, pull head 5, withdraw from air-cooled push rod 2, and close cooling wind;
Screw on rotating rod 11, to hollow jack 9 head, starts Pu pump and is pulled out by filling pipe end 6;
Pull bar 11, pull head 5 separate, and hollow jack 9 moves to standby position, close power supply, unload bracing frame 7 and pull head 5.
Use the present invention, need operate the most in order, have to check for each equipment tool before using whether normal, confirm that bracing frame 7 is fixing, pull bar 11, pull head 5 connect fixing, pull bar 11 and be connected with hollow jack 9 to fix and restart Pu pump;
Use the duty of middle close attention hollow jack 9, as worked slowly in found hollow jack 9, must close power supply immediately, check pull head 5 whether centering, check hollow jack 9 whether fault, and process in time.
Using the present invention, Employee population is reduced to 4 people by 8 original people, and per tour can save worker 4 people, and the first and second the third fourths four groups save 16 people altogether, and scene has four ladle nozzle provision for disengagement stations, saves 64 people altogether.Work time cost be 200 yuan/man day/.
Work time cost can be saved the whole year: 64 people × 200 yuan/man day × 30/ day month × December/year=460.8 ten thousand yuan/year.
